
Marion Center offense explodes in third quarter to beat Northern Cambria!
Tagged under: District 6, Game Photos-Videos, News, pfn, Scoreboard
Greg Ricupero | October 4, 2025
GRSN GAME OF THE WEEK
Marion Center Stingers (6-0) at Northern Cambria Colts (3-3)
Last Meeting 9/27/24 Colts 32 @ Stingers 0
Marion Center remains unbeaten after big second half at Northern Cambria!
Just like last week the Stingers made a slew of first half mistakes but led at the intermission.
The Stingers fumbled at the Colts 2, committed three personal fouls on a 95 yard TD drive and had multiple penalties on another Colt touchdown drive.
1st Half
-Colts go for it on 4th & 3 from near middle field but are stuffed by the Stingers defense.
-Stingers go 50 yards with Cam Rising scoring on an 18 yard run MC 7-0
-Colts 3 plays & a punt
-Stingers drive 62 yards inside the NC 5 and fumble
-Colts drive 95 yards using over 6 & half minutes aided by 3 personal fouls. Kirsch scores on a 4th and 1 ? Kick is missed MC 7-6
-MC & NC 3 plays and a punt
-Stingers drive 54 yards with #7 Troy Slovinsky scoring on a 4 yard run MC 14-6
-Colts go 81 yards in 3 minutes aided by a defensive pass interference and another personal foul, Daniel Farrell hits Reese Wagner on a beautiful wheel route, but NC fails on conversion MC 14-12
-Stingers go 68 yards in 46 seconds, Rising runs around like Roger Staubach and throws a beautiful pass to Alec Brudnock who makes a great catch for a 48 yard touchdown MC 21-12 thanks to Josh Troup third conversion
-Colts have ball as half runs out

2nd Half
-Stingers fumble opening kickoff
-Colts score in 11 seconds on a 41 yard pass from Daniel Farrell to Kirsch – a great catch in coverage and he runs away from the defenders MC 21-19
-MC THROWS A SWITCH ON-they will score 3 touchdowns in 7 minutes 7 seconds
-Stingers go 70 yards in less than 2 minutes, Rising hits Trent Slovinsky with a 24 yard touchdown pass -Colts jump off sides on PAT and Rising plows in for two points MC 29-19
-NC STARTS NEXT 3 DRIVES AT THEIR OWN 20 or less – thanks to Troup’s kickoffs and the special teams tackling of Joseph Shipley
-Colts 3 plays & punt -snap goes over punters head who punts as he is picking it up in the end zone
-Stingers start at NC 14, drive ends with a Rising 12 yard touchdown-Troup PAT makes it a 3 score game and the fight drains out of the Colts MC 36-19
-Colts drive ends with a Brudnock interception
-Stingers go 61 yards in three and a half minutes -touchdown a Rising to Brudnock pass MC 43-19
-Colts & Stingers 3 plays and a punt
-Colts stopped near midfield on 4th & 17
-Stingers use five and a half minutes to go 60 yards, Tyler Phillips 6 yard touchdown run MC 49-19
-JV ENTERS GAME
-Colts Austin Bougher scores on 1st play MC 49-26
-Stingers 3 plays and a punt
-Colts just miss a long TD pass and on next play run it to the one, game over
The Colts played well for two plus quarters. Coach Sam Shutty has done a great job with his team after losing half of it to graduation. The Colts are still in the hunt for a D6 playoff spot and have a big game at Penns Manor next week. Danny Farrell is an awesome young man to watch and Zak Kirsch is a two way beast.
The Stingers may be surprising the community but not me. What a great cast of characters. Led by Cam Rising who gets better every week. You know how I feel about #7 who scored again. Trent Slovinsky added a TD but his defensive play was outstanding tonight. Carter Knox looked like Ndamukong Suh. Alec keeps making the big catch. Josh Troup has been money and his kickoffs outstanding. Stormer does it all from playing undersized tackle to pressuring the quarterback. Michael runs hard on every play delivering as good as he gets. TP awesome as usually, I have known him since 9th grade. No one is tougher pound for pound. I’m sure I missed a couple. Next week they are home against Purchase Line.
